Understanding the Georgia Department of Labor Structure

The Georgia Department of Labor is the state agency responsible for administering unemployment insurance, workforce development, and ensuring compliance with state labor laws. This structure is designed to protect workers and assist employers in maintaining a stable economic environment. Utilizing the Online Resource Network

While physical ga dept of labor locations remain vital for in-person transactions, the department has heavily invested in digital infrastructure. Many routine interactions, such as checking claim status or registering for benefits, can be handled online. This hybrid model allows individuals to determine the most efficient path for their needs, whether that is a virtual consultation or a visit to a physical office listed in the official directory.

Planning Your Visit and Preparing Documentation

To ensure a productive trip to any ga dept of labor locations, preparation is key. Gathering necessary identification, social security numbers, and previous employer information streamlines the process significantly. Walking into an office without the required documents can result in delays and the need for return trips. By reviewing the checklist provided on the official department website, visitors can maximize their time and resolve their labor concerns in a single visit.
